Choosing Your Lifter: Weight and Materials

Selecting the right lifter requires an understanding of the surface texture and the total weight of the object. Smooth, polished glass or metal surfaces are ideal for standard vacuum cups, while textured surfaces demand tools designed for porosity.

  • Weight capacity: Always account for the weight of the material plus a 20% safety margin.
  • Surface texture: Use electric pumps for porous stone and manual pumps for glass.
  • Number of cups: Longer panels require two or more lifters to prevent snapping or loss of balance.

Do not assume a lifter’s maximum rating applies to all surfaces. A tool rated for 200 pounds on glass might only hold 50 pounds on a textured countertop.

Avoiding Disaster: Critical Safety Checks

Never trust a seal blindly, regardless of the brand. Before lifting, perform a “bounce test” by lifting the material only a few inches off the ground to ensure the seal holds.

Always check the rubber pad for debris or nicks before every use. Even a small grain of sand can create a leak path that compromises the vacuum.

If a lifter has a warning indicator, such as a red line, ensure it is fully retracted or not visible. A failing vacuum is silent and invisible until it is too late; never ignore the secondary safety indicators provided by the tool.

Best Practices for a Strong Reliable Seal

The secret to a perfect seal is surface preparation. Clean the material with a non-oily glass cleaner or isopropyl alcohol to remove dust, grease, and grime before attaching the cup.

Apply a small amount of moisture or light oil to the rubber pad if the surface is slightly dusty, as this helps create a more airtight seal. Always press down firmly while actuating the pump to ensure the air is fully evacuated from the cup.

Never walk under a hanging panel, and always keep the panel as close to the ground as possible. Use a two-person team whenever the panel size exceeds the wingspan of a single operator.

Lifter Care: How to Maintain Your Suction Cups

Rubber pads are the most vulnerable part of the tool and should be protected from harsh solvents and direct sunlight. Store lifters in their protective cases when not in use to prevent the pads from deforming or picking up grit.

Periodically clean the vacuum check-valve to ensure the pump maintains pressure effectively. If the plunger starts to feel stiff or gritty, a tiny dab of silicone-based lubricant on the pump seal can restore smooth operation.

Inspect the rubber for cracks or hardening annually. If the pad feels dry and brittle rather than soft and supple, it is time to replace it, as it will no longer guarantee a reliable grip.
